Electrode and Microstructure Dependence of Oxygen Diffusion in Ferroelectric Hafnium Zirconium Oxide Thin Films

open access: yesAdvanced Functional Materials, EarlyView.
Significant nanoscale oxygen diffusion coefficient variations are measured in ferroelectric hafnium zirconium oxide films with grain boundaries and electrode interfaces exhibiting values 104 times larger than the grain cores. Overall coefficients are 10X larger for films prepared with metal nitride electrodes compared to refractory metals. New insights

2D Co‐Assembly of Solid Acids Enables Stable Superprotonic Conduction Above 260°C

open access: yesAdvanced Functional Materials, EarlyView.
A two‐dimensional co‐assembly strategy integrates antimony phosphate and phosphotungstic acid nanosheets into free‐standing inorganic lamellar membranes with confined acid–acid interfaces. The resulting interfacial hydrogen‐bond network enables anhydrous proton conductivity exceeding 0.1 S cm−1 at 260°C and supports stable high‐temperature fuel‐cell ...

Comparative Model Estimates of Interception Loss in a Coniferous Forest Stand

open access: yesHydrology Research, 1996
Measurements of throughfall in a coniferous forest stand were analyzed and compared with model estimates of interception loss using three different types of models: the Nordic HBV model, the AMOR model and a simplified Rutter model. Two years of seasonal data were available.

Roll‐to‐Roll Processable EC/TC Hybrid Smart Windows Driven by a Bidirectional Dual‐Chromic Polymer Electrolyte

open access: yesAdvanced Functional Materials, EarlyView.
We present a scalable EC/TC hybrid smart window using a DCPE that enables tunable solar modulation (ΔTsol:15–43%), fast electrochromic switching (<90 s), and strong thermal blocking (10–14°C reduction). HPMC improves thermal stability, while an optimized ISL enhances EC performance.
